How they compare
Syrian Arab Republic currently reports 0.71 deaths per 100,000 people against 0.66 deaths per 100,000 people in Costa Rica, a difference of 0.05 deaths per 100,000 people.
That makes Syrian Arab Republic's figure about 1.1 times Costa Rica's.
Across all 22 years both countries report, Syrian Arab Republic has been ahead every year.
Costa Rica ranks 67th and Syrian Arab Republic ranks 64th of 194 countries.
Syrian Arab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Costa Rica | Syrian Arab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.293 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.577 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.284 deaths per 100,000 people | Syrian Arab Republic |
| 2010s | 0.395 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.694 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.299 deaths per 100,000 people | Syrian Arab Republic |
| 2020s | 0.545 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.7 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.155 deaths per 100,000 people | Syrian Arab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
